About Jonathan Safran Foer

Jonathan Safran Foer is an acclaimed American author born on February 21, 1977, known for his innovative narrative style and exploration of complex themes such as memory, identity, and the human condition. He gained widespread recognition with his debut novel, "Everything Is Illuminated," which was both a critical and commercial success, later adapted into a feature film. Foer's other significant works include "Extremely Loud and Incredibly Close" and "Eating Animals," reflecting his deep engagement with themes of empathy and the ethical considerations of food.
